The Titans: Classic Rock Legends You Should Know
These bands defined an era and remain unchallenged in influence and popularity:
1. Led Zeppelin
A cornerstone of hard rock, Led Zeppelin’s fusion of blues, folk, and mysticism created a sound that’s both explosive and poetic. Tracks like Stairway to Heaven and Whole Lotta Love remain defining moments in rock history.
2. Pink Floyd
Known for their immersive soundscapes and conceptual depth, Pink Floyd transformed rock into a cinematic experience with albums like Dark Side of the Moon and The Wall.

3. The Rolling Stones
With gritty swagger and timeless hits like (I Can’t Get No) Satisfaction,—their enduring legacy beautifully captures the rebellious spirit of classic rock.
4. The Who
Pioneers of rock innovation, The Who combined raw energy with theatricality, delivering classics such as Baba O’Riley and My Generation.
5. Queen
A symphony in itself, Queen blended operatic grandeur with pop pulse. Freddie Mercury’s commanding stage presence and hits like Bohemian Rhapsody solidify their place as rock royalty.
